Assertive Community Treatment Team (Former Employee) - Stratford, ON - 23 June 2022
My skills (education and experience) were under utilized and I therefore felt no sense of pride or accomplishment in my work. When assaulted by patients, myself and coworkers were denied reviews of the situation as to how things could have been managed differently. Instead, we were offered platitudes such as “I know you did your best”, or “you know s/he’s not well”. These were not helpful in any way. Overall, not a great work environment because of poor management.

Environmental Services Aide (Current Employee) - Seaforth, ON - 7 November 2014
I enjoy my job and the people I work with. My supervisor is excellent. I am looking for advancement and none is provided at this time.
The most rewarding part and most difficult part of my job is people. Meaning, we as Environmental Service support personnel basically are customer service representatives to staff, patients, families and public.
